NX framework icon

NX framework

NX framework icon

NX framework

  1
Бесплатное ПО Открытый код
Категории: Разработка
Платформы: Linux Web Windows Mac
Особенности:
web-development легко использовать javascript framework



Ядро NX - это крошечная библиотека, отвечающая только за одну вещь. Это
позволяет создавать и комбинировать компоненты и промежуточное программное
обеспечение. Компонент выполняет свои промежуточные программы, когда он
подключен к DOM, и получает от них все дополнительные функции. NX поставляется
с некоторыми основными промежуточными программами, которые вы можете найти в
списке ниже.

\- Текстовая интерполяция: интерполировать значения из кода в представление
динамически или одноразово. Включает в себя дополнительные фильтры.
\- Динамические и пользовательские атрибуты: используйте одноразовые или
динамически оцениваемые собственные атрибуты или определяйте некоторые
пользовательские.
\- Обработка событий: добавьте встроенные обработчики событий для
прослушивания любого события. Включает в себя дополнительные ограничители
скорости.
\- Визуальный поток: используйте условные блоки и циклы внутри представления
HTML.
\- Привязка данных: односторонняя, одноразовая или двусторонняя привязка
данных к любому событию и без крайних случаев.
\- Рендеринг: Модульная код HTML и CSS, перемещая их в отдельные файлы для
каждого компонента.
\- Маршрутизация: простая, но мощная маршрутизация с автоматической
синхронизацией параметров и событиями маршрутизатора.
\- Динамическое моделирование: упрощение стиля путем передачи объектов в
атрибуты style и class.
\- Анимации: создавайте мощные анимации, используя только несколько атрибутов
HTML.
\- Все остальное, что вы определяете с помощью простого синтаксиса функции
middleware (elem, state, next) {}.

Их можно комбинировать для создания компонентов с желаемой функциональностью.
Альтернативно готовые основные компоненты могут быть расширены и использованы,
чтобы избежать стандартного кода.

Аналоги (15):

  • AngularJS

    HTML отлично подходит для объявления статических документов, но он прерывается, когда мы пытаемся использовать его для объявления ...
      99
    Бесплатное ПО Открытый код
    Linux Web Windows Mac
    встроенная маршрутизация javascript-library developer-tools dynamic-html framework mvc-pattern javascript web-development mvc
  • Vue.js

    Интуитивно понятный, быстрый и составной MVVM для создания интерактивных интерфейсов
      64
    Бесплатное ПО Открытый код
    self-hosted расширяемый с помощью плагинов/расширений mvvm frontend javascript-library двухстороннее связывание данных
  • React

    Библиотека JavaScript для создания пользовательских интерфейсов
      44
    Бесплатное ПО Открытый код
    Linux Web Windows Mac
    javascript-library developer-tools ui-framework модульная система javascript-development отображение аргументов web-development пользовательский интерфейс просмотр абстракции слоя
  • Polymer

    Polymer - это библиотека, которая использует новейшие веб-технологии для создания пользовательских элементов HTML.
      26
    Бесплатное ПО Открытый код
    Mac Linux Windows
    developer-tools framework javascript-development web-development mvc
  • ember.js

    Платформа Javascript MVC (Model View Controller)
      22
    Бесплатное ПО Открытый код
    Web
    javascript-library mvc-pattern javascript
  • Backbone.js

    Backbone предоставляет структуру для приложений, насыщенных JavaScript, предоставляя моделям ключ-значение ...
      16
    Бесплатное ПО Открытый код
    Web
    javascript-library javascript framework mvc
  • KnockoutJS

    Knockout - это библиотека JavaScript, которая поможет вам создать богатый, отзывчивый пользовательский интерфейс для отображения и редактирования ...
      15
    Бесплатное ПО Открытый код
    Mac Linux Windows
    javascript-library developer-tools framework mvc-pattern javascript web-development mvc
  • Aurelia

    Aurelia - это клиентская среда JavaScript, которая использует простые соглашения для расширения возможностей вашего ...
      13
    Бесплатное ПО Открытый код
    Linux Web Windows Mac
    web-development application-framework javascript-framework
  • Durandal

    Durandal - это межплатформенная клиентская среда для нескольких устройств, написанная на JavaScript и предназначенная для ...
      7
    Бесплатное ПО Открытый код
    Mac Linux Windows
    coffeescript web-applications html5 реляционное сопоставление объектов mvc javascript-library developer-tools dynamic-views web-application-development dynamic-html framework css mvc-pattern javascript web-development web-application
  • KnockbackJS

    И Knockout.js, и Backbone.js имеют свои сильные и слабые стороны, но вместе они удивительны!
      6
    Бесплатное ПО Открытый код
    Mac Linux Windows
    реляционное сопоставление объектов javascript-library developer-tools dynamic-views framework mvc-pattern javascript web-development mvc
  • mithril

    Mithril - это крошечный современный клиентский Javascript-фреймворк с маршрутизацией и XHR.
      5
    Бесплатное ПО Открытый код
    Web
    javascript-framework framework javascript spa mvc
  • RiotJS

    Простая и элегантная библиотека на основе компонентов.
      4
    Бесплатное ПО Открытый код
    Web
    webdev library framework javascript frontend riot
  • Svelte

    Компонентная структура на основе компилятора, которая создает эффективный код для хирургического обновления DOM
      3
    Бесплатное ПО Открытый код
    javascript-library developer-tools framework javascript-development self-hosted mvc-pattern javascript frontend web-development
  • Cyclow

    A reactive frontend framework for JavaScript.
      1
    Бесплатное ПО Открытый код
    Linux Web Windows Mac
    javascript framework frontend
  • Microsoft Web Framework

    MWF - это система, которая позволяет авторам сайтов подумать, как лучше всего рассказать историю Microsoft ...
      1
    Бесплатное ПО Открытый код
    self-hosted web-framework